Data Science

When talking about data science, we can say that it is one of the rapidly emerging trends in computing. It is also a vast multi-disciplinary area. All of the subjects namely computer science, programming, economics software engineering, mathematics and statistics, and business management, come under the umbrella of Data Science. Data science involves the collection, analysis, management, preparation, visualization, and storage of large volumes of information.

To explain Data science in a much simpler way, it can be perceived as having strong links with databases including big data and computer science. A person who studies Data science is a Data Scientist. Data Science is a Specialized Skill

Since Data Science is a specialized skill. It involves the understanding of the following:

  • It is designed and implemented using 4A's. 4 A's are Data Architecture, Acquisition, Analysis, and Archival.

  • It involves the application of advanced techniques in mathematics and statistics to model data for deep analysis

  • It involves adequate programming and development skills, algorithm development skills

  • Learning analytical and ethical reasoning skills

  • Understanding communication and business skills

We can conclude that data science is an interdisciplinary area and needs diverse skill sets to gain mastery in this domain. Moreover, data scientists are supposed to be familiar with business models and paradigms. They can be considered as the professionals who can ask good business questions to obtain meaningful insights from given data sets.

Statistics

On defining the field of Statistics, one can say that it is another broad subject which deals with the study of data and is widely applied in various fields. Statistics can be considered as a methodology that helps in making conclusions from data.

Statistics can refer to the mathematical analysis which uses quantified models to represent a given set of data. By studying statistics, you will be able to understand different methods to gather data, analyze them and interpret results. These methods are commonly used by scientists, researchers, and mathematicians in solving problems. Even though statistics shows the procedures to collect data, it also helps in taking out the information from numerical and categorical data. Over here, the categorical data refers to unique data. That unique data can be the blood group of a person, marital status, etc. 

Statistics play an important role in data related studies

It plays an important role, as statistics can help us to:

  • Decide what type of data required to address a given problem

  • It reaches to organize and sum up data

  • Moreover, its studies are used in the analysis to be done to conclude data

  • It can help in knowing the effectiveness of results and to evaluate uncertainties

Moreover, statistics limits itself with tools such as frequency analysis, mean, median, variance analysis, correlation, and regression etc. With the help of Statistical studies, you will be able to focus on analysis using standard techniques involving mathematical formulas and methods.
